Pours a very murky, dark amber color with a very thick yellow, off-white head that leaves tremendous lacing as it goes down. Aroma is very full of a great mixture of hops; citrus notes are very pungent, a nice piny background bitterness is present and a light spicy nose too. Flavor begins with a very strong and full citrus and pine bitterness which lightens as it moves into a middle where the caramel and Munich malt sweetness and roasted notes really come out and the beer finishes with a deep bitter bite. Beer is thick but not as thick as I would of expected with the sweetness and it has a very creamy and smooth. I can honestly say I was a bit worried because this beer is sooooo hyped but in all honesty it stands up to expectations and one I could see being a regular beer if on tap at a bar in my area. This beer is honestly very well balanced and no one aspect of it stands out but as a whole they completely meld making a truly fantastic brew.
